There has been a great deal of controversy over the role that poor digestion and/or absorption of dietary sugars may play in aggravating the sensitive stomach symptoms. Poor digestion of lactose, the sugar in milk, is very common as is poor absorption of fructose, a sweetener found in many processed foods. Poor digestion or absorption of these sugars could aggravate the symptoms of the sensitive stomach since unabsorbed sugars often cause increased formation of gas.
